Страница 8 из 20 ПерваяПервая ... 67891018 ... ПоследняяПоследняя
Показано с 71 по 80 из 239

Тема: Временная тема

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Пользователь
    Регистрация
    21.01.2011
    Адрес
    еБург
    Сообщений
    890

    По умолчанию

    Цитата Сообщение от vladimirisitnikov Посмотреть сообщение
    Есть факт: без моих доводок у макроса AI было 2 проблемы. Либо низкая точность, либо долгая работа -- требовалось много циклов прежде чем значение окончательно вычислится.
    "долгая работа" - это я просто хотел продемонстрировать вам возможность написания полноценных циклов на ПР, т.к. вы утверждали что это не возможно, практической цели не стояло....

    ваше улучшения я использовал просто потому что я не гордый, и могу использовать чужой алгоритм, если он мне покажется немного лучше...
    но и без него всё работало замечательно, просто надо было добавить одну итерацию...
    PS в крайнем случае можно было написать 2 макроса - один для больших значений, другой для близких к 1
    ("близкие" - это x или 1/x <18e18)
    Последний раз редактировалось AI!; 18.07.2016 в 20:58.
    начинающий профессионал

  2. #2

    По умолчанию

    Цитата Сообщение от AI! Посмотреть сообщение
    "долгая работа" - это я просто хотел продемонстрировать вам возможность написания полноценных циклов на ПР, т.к. вы утверждали что это не возможно, практической цели не стояло....
    Я же про циклы внутри одного "ПР такта".
    Ну, так, чтобы "за 1 такт ПР" выполнился цикл, без copy&paste блоков.

    То, что можно за несколько ПР циклов итеративно что-то вычислить "и ежу понятно". Ну, сама возможность мне понятна и без примеров.
    Или я что-то просмотрел и там за 1 ПР цикл выполнялся цикл в макросе?

    Цитата Сообщение от AI! Посмотреть сообщение
    ваше улучшения я использовал просто потому что я не гордый, и могу использовать чужой алгоритм, если он мне покажется немного лучше...
    но и без него всё работало замечательно, просто надо было добавить одну итерацию...
    PS в крайнем случае можно было написать 2 макроса - один для больших значений, другой для близких к 1
    ("близкие" - это x или 1/x <18e18)
    Полагаю, это был ответ на
    Цитата Сообщение от rovki Посмотреть сообщение
    Не надо примазываться к логарифму АI . макрос и без ваших доводок нормально работал
    rovki, видите, мои доработки учтены, макрос стал лучше, трава зеленее и всё такое.

  3. #3

    По умолчанию

    Цитата Сообщение от vladimirisitnikov Посмотреть сообщение
    rovki, видите, мои доработки учтены, макрос стал лучше, трава зеленее и всё такое.
    Вы, Бога ради, меня извините, но у меня ощущение, что в детстве/юности, Вас очень сильно огорчила концепция ПЛК в частности, либо Вы довольно толстый тролль.
    Либо, самый конченный, и вероятный вариант - Вас обидели и выгнали с хабра.
    Вы действительно не понимаете, о чем спорите, или правда некомпетентны? Вы действительно не хотите внимательно прочитать название темы, и первую страницу, или Вам настолько доставляет удовольствие в словоблудии, что это не имеет значения?

  4. #4

    По умолчанию

    Господа ! окститесь !!! вы во что форум превращаете ???? угомонитесь !!!! на форум люди заходят чтобы помощь найти !
    а Вы во что его превращаете ??? там с начала куча вопросов НУЖНЫХ пользователям плк - на которые ответа нет !
    а вы в дебрях бездонных сознания вашего всех уже распугали кто и интересовался вопросом данной темы !
    первому совет - можешь - напиши , поясни , а люди оценят - долго ждать не придется !
    (типа , как Игорь - вот то что вы ищете , работает так-то , только вот это добавьте вот сюда ,
    для того-то , и делает оно вот то-то , остальное поймете (наверное)))
    и не стоит горлом брать ...
    второму (автору , автору темы , и соавторам которые так и молчат "как рыба об лед" ) - лучше поясните как работает то что работает - ибо них..чего не понятно - тогда бы гости , пользователи ( и все остальные кто умом по меньше ) - лучше бы поняли принципы работы плк !
    (автору темы мое глубокое почтение и светлая память в моём рассудке на веки вечные за качественную учёбу!)
    Последний раз редактировалось вут; 17.07.2016 в 03:29.
    С уважением , Денис Кучеренко .
    Знание некоторых принципов - легко заменяет не знание некоторых фактов ...

  5. #5
    Пользователь Аватар для rovki
    Регистрация
    03.01.2010
    Адрес
    Чехов
    Сообщений
    12,150

    По умолчанию

    Для справки (тема навеяла)- удалось "поймать" энтропию часов реального времени в ПР .То есть в идеале (симуляторе) все стабильно и однообразно ,а на реальном железе имеет место быть флуктуация времени между циклами ПР и часами реального времени ПР .В течении секунды разброс составляет 1 цикл ПР ....Думаю в ПЛК ,с учетом большей скорости ,разброс можно вычислить точнее .При анализе в течении минуты разброс становится еще больше ...
    Значит можно придумать не только вычислительные алгоритмы , но и использовать "железную" флуктуацию .
    ПС. Заодно фичу ОЛ выловил ,но об этом в другой теме .
    Последний раз редактировалось rovki; 17.07.2016 в 09:32.
    электронщик до мозга костей и не только

  6. #6
    Пользователь Аватар для rovki
    Регистрация
    03.01.2010
    Адрес
    Чехов
    Сообщений
    12,150

    По умолчанию

    Цитата Сообщение от rovki Посмотреть сообщение
    Для справки (тема навеяла)- удалось "поймать" энтропию часов реального времени в ПР .
    Стоит только поднести ФЭН к кварцу на плате ,так разница возрастает ...но об этом в другой теме .
    электронщик до мозга костей и не только

  7. #7

    По умолчанию

    Вы предлагаете на глаз определить распределение случайной величины ? Есть стандартные тесты, ими и надо пользоваться.

  8. #8
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,579

    По умолчанию

    Цитата Сообщение от Вольд Посмотреть сообщение
    Вы предлагаете на глаз определить распределение случайной величины ? Есть стандартные тесты, ими и надо пользоваться.
    решили подогреть разговор, давайте. В двух словах расскажите о стандартном тесте, чтоб его можно было реализовать в плк, я сколько уже третьи сутки прошу дать такой инструмент, ни кто сместа не сдвинулся, начал сам готовить для себя тесты и сразу "повылазили" спецы, которым не нравиться мой подход
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

    среди успешных людей я не встречала нытиков
    Барбара Коркоран

  9. #9
    Пользователь Аватар для capzap
    Регистрация
    25.02.2011
    Адрес
    Киров
    Сообщений
    10,579

    По умолчанию

    Поймите же наконец. Слова "ни один из них не прошел тест" без упоминаний методики/критериев и названия теста ничего не значат
    Вы сами дали ссылки, т.к. я русскоговорящий я не помню как она называется , надо было конкретно называть что имели ввиду, раз уж сами не собираетесь ни чего делать

    Кто же _заставляет_ всегда использовать одни и те же начальные значения?
    Вы и заставляете, кто мне задавал вопрос правильные ли я значения инициализировал, значит есть еще и не правильные, тогда как можно подставлять случайный набор? Естественно я подставлял, генерировал кусок кода из sha и тем неменее
    Bad programmers worry about the code. Good programmers worry about data structures and their relationships

    среди успешных людей я не встречала нытиков
    Барбара Коркоран

  10. #10

    По умолчанию

    Цитата Сообщение от capzap Посмотреть сообщение
    Вы сами дали ссылки, т.к. я русскоговорящий я не помню как она называется , надо было конкретно называть что имели ввиду, раз уж сами не собираетесь ни чего делать
    Т.е. "использована неизвестная методика которая неизвестно что вернула"? Тогда это возврат к стадии "только в вашем мозгу".

    Обычно, делают так:
    1) Либо реализуют алгоритм ГСЧ на C
    2) Либо генерируют длинную последовательность, сохраняют в файл и прогоняют через тот же тестирущий софт.

    Цитата Сообщение от capzap Посмотреть сообщение
    Вы и заставляете, кто мне задавал вопрос правильные ли я значения инициализировал, значит есть еще и не правильные, тогда как можно подставлять случайный набор? Естественно я подставлял, генерировал кусок кода из sha и тем неменее
    Где заставляю? Ссылку в студию.

Страница 8 из 20 ПерваяПервая ... 67891018 ... ПоследняяПоследняя

Похожие темы

  1. Тема для диплома
    от Gordan007 в разделе Трёп (Курилка)
    Ответов: 13
    Последнее сообщение: 18.01.2014, 12:08
  2. Бродит тема..
    от energohran в разделе Разработки
    Ответов: 3
    Последнее сообщение: 10.04.2012, 12:53
  3. МОДУС: тема защиты прошивки
    от Elka в разделе Модус 5684-0
    Ответов: 1
    Последнее сообщение: 28.11.2011, 22:39
  4. Язык ST. Временная задержка.
    от neoarey в разделе ПЛК1хх
    Ответов: 10
    Последнее сообщение: 26.03.2011, 01:15
  5. Ответов: 61
    Последнее сообщение: 12.09.2008, 09:49

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•